## Build Provenance: Fernpipe SDK Parity (Swift vs. Kotlin)

Hey plugin folks — both Fernpipe client SDKs are cut from the same spec repo, so feature parity is enforced at build time, not by hand. If the Kotlin build ships an API the Swift build lacks, the release bot blocks the tag. You can verify which spec revision your SDK came from using the token below.

session token of yahof-bajeg = htk9_0d43d44ed

## Configuration

Quick notes for support folks on the FoldFox laundry-locker flow. When a customer taps "unlock" in the app, the request hits our locker gateway, which checks the reservation and pops the door. Most settings are in `.env` on the gateway box: `FOLDFOX_LOCKER_TIMEOUT` sets how long a door stays open, and `FOLDFOX_SITE` names the kiosk cluster. The gateway also signs each unlock request, and the signing credential goes on the next line of that file.

vault entry, yahif-yajep: COURIER_KEY29=b802bdf8034096b65a51c6ba5abe2

## Data Stores — DeployBuddy

DeployBuddy is our little chat bot that answers "is prod deploying right now?" so folks stop pinging the release channel. It keeps things simple: one Postgres instance holds deploy events, rollout states, and the per-channel notification prefs. Nothing exotic — no caching layer yet, since traffic is tiny. When reviewing, pay attention to the event-state transitions table; that's where most of the tricky logic lives. For local review against the shared dev instance, connect with the following:

replica DSN, kajep-yahag: mssql://praok_svc:iF@db-8d68.plorvaio.local:5432/eliion

**Vendor note: Inkmill markdown pipeline**

Rendering for Parchway docs is outsourced to Inkmill under an annual contract, renewing each March. They handle sanitization and PDF export; we own the upload queue. SLA: 4-hour response on rendering failures. Escalate only after two failed retries. Their support desk is reachable at the address below.

billing contact of hahaf-baguf = zorael.tammir.jorius@sivrelhq.internal